大数据技术好学什么课程
作者:多攻略家
|
193人看过
发布时间:2026-05-16 04:32:02
标签:大数据技术好学什么课程
大数据技术好学什么课程?在当今信息化迅猛发展的时代,大数据技术已成为各行各业不可或缺的重要工具。它不仅改变了传统行业的运作模式,还催生了大量新兴的岗位与职业。对于初学者而言,学习大数据技术是一条既充满挑战又充满机遇的旅程。本文将从多个
大数据技术好学什么课程?
在当今信息化迅猛发展的时代,大数据技术已成为各行各业不可或缺的重要工具。它不仅改变了传统行业的运作模式,还催生了大量新兴的岗位与职业。对于初学者而言,学习大数据技术是一条既充满挑战又充满机遇的旅程。本文将从多个角度探讨大数据技术学习的课程体系,帮助读者明确学习路径,提升学习效率。
一、大数据技术概述与学习目标
大数据技术是指利用先进的数据处理工具和算法,从海量数据中提取有价值的信息,从而支持决策和优化运营的科学方法。大数据技术涉及的数据范围广泛,数据量巨大,处理方式复杂,因此学习大数据技术需要系统性的知识体系。
学习大数据技术的目标包括:掌握数据采集、存储、处理、分析、可视化等关键技术,了解大数据在不同行业的应用,培养数据思维能力,提升解决实际问题的能力。学习过程中,不仅需要扎实的编程基础,还需要理解数据科学的基本原理,以及大数据平台的使用方法。
二、大数据技术学习的基础课程
1. 编程语言与数据处理
编程是大数据技术学习的基础,掌握一门或多门编程语言(如Python、Java、R等)是入门的必要条件。Python因其简洁易懂、功能强大,在大数据领域应用广泛,是学习大数据技术的首选语言。
学习Python时,应重点掌握数据结构、算法、函数、类、模块等基础知识。此外,学习数据处理相关工具如Pandas、NumPy、Matplotlib等,有助于提升数据操作能力。
2. 数据库与数据存储
数据存储是大数据技术的重要环节。学习数据库的基本概念与结构,包括关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B、Redis),是掌握数据处理流程的关键。
在学习过程中,应熟悉数据库的设计、优化、备份与恢复机制,以及数据索引、查询、事务处理等技能。同时,了解分布式数据库如Hadoop、HBase等的原理,也是学习大数据技术的重要内容。
3. 大数据平台与工具
大数据技术的核心在于平台与工具的使用。常见的大数据平台包括Hadoop、Spark、Flink、Hive、HBase、MapReduce等。学习这些平台的原理、配置、使用方法以及性能调优是掌握大数据技术的关键。
此外,学习大数据可视化工具如Tableau、Power BI、Python的Matplotlib、Seaborn等,也能够提升数据呈现与分析的能力。
4. 数据分析与机器学习
数据分析是大数据技术的核心应用之一。学习数据清洗、数据挖掘、数据建模、统计分析等技能,是提升数据价值的关键。同时,掌握机器学习算法与模型,如线性回归、决策树、随机森林、神经网络等,也是大数据技术学习的重要内容。
在学习过程中,应注重实际案例的分析与实践,以增强对数据科学的理解与应用能力。
三、大数据技术学习的进阶课程
5. 大数据处理与计算
学习大数据处理与计算是掌握大数据技术的重要环节。掌握分布式计算框架如Hadoop、Spark、Flink等,是提升数据处理效率的关键。
在学习过程中,应重点掌握分布式计算的基本原理、任务调度、数据分布与分区、容错机制等。此外,学习Spark的RDD、DataFrame、DAG等概念,也是提升大数据处理能力的重要内容。
6. 数据科学与统计学
数据科学与统计学是大数据技术学习的重要支撑学科。学习统计学的基本概念,如概率、假设检验、回归分析、置信区间等,是理解数据背后的规律和趋势的基础。
同时,学习数据科学中的机器学习、特征工程、模型评估与优化等技能,也是提升数据分析能力的重要内容。
7. 数据可视化与报告
数据可视化是将复杂的数据转化为直观的图表和报告的重要手段。学习数据可视化工具如Tableau、Power BI、Python的Plotly、Matplotlib、Seaborn等,是提升数据沟通能力的关键。
在学习过程中,应注重图表的设计、数据的呈现方式以及报告的撰写技巧,以增强数据表达与传播的能力。
四、大数据技术学习的实践课程
8. 数据采集与处理实践
数据采集与处理是大数据技术应用的起点。学习数据采集工具如Scrapy、Selenium、Apache Nifi等,是掌握数据获取与处理流程的基础。
在实践过程中,应熟悉数据清洗、去重、分组、统计等操作,以及数据导出与导入的方法,以提升数据处理能力。
9. 大数据项目实践
大数据项目实践是检验学习成果的重要方式。通过参与实际项目,如数据分析、数据建模、数据可视化等,可以提升实际操作能力和团队协作能力。
在项目实践中,应注重问题分析、数据处理、模型构建、结果呈现等环节,以增强对大数据技术的理解与应用能力。
五、大数据技术学习的行业应用与职业发展
10. 大数据在各行业的应用
大数据技术已经广泛应用于金融、医疗、教育、制造、零售、政府等多个行业。例如,在金融行业,大数据技术用于风险控制、欺诈检测和投资决策;在医疗行业,大数据技术用于疾病预测、药物研发和个性化治疗;在教育行业,大数据技术用于学生行为分析、课程推荐和教学优化。
学习大数据技术,不仅能够掌握核心技术,还能了解大数据在不同行业的应用,为未来的职业发展打下坚实基础。
11. 大数据相关职业发展路径
大数据技术的学习,为个人职业发展提供了广阔的空间。常见的职业包括数据分析师、数据科学家、大数据工程师、数据可视化设计师、数据产品经理等。
在职业发展过程中,应注重提升专业技能,积累项目经验,加强行业认知,以提高就业竞争力。
六、大数据技术学习的注意事项
12. 学习路径的规划与持续学习
学习大数据技术是一项长期的过程,需要合理规划学习路径,分阶段掌握基础知识,逐步深入学习高级技能。同时,应保持持续学习,关注行业动态,提升自身竞争力。
13. 实践与理论结合
理论学习与实践操作相结合是提升学习效果的关键。通过实际项目、案例分析、实验操作等方式,能够更深入地理解大数据技术的原理与应用。
14. 专业认证与职业发展
获得大数据相关的专业认证,如阿里云大数据工程师、Hadoop认证、Spark认证等,是提升职业竞争力的重要途径。同时,应关注行业内的职业发展机会,积极参与行业交流与合作,拓展职业网络。
大数据技术的学习是一个系统而复杂的工程,涉及多个学科和技能。从基础的编程语言与数据处理,到进阶的大数据平台与分析工具,再到实际项目的实践与职业发展,学习路径清晰而严谨。对于初学者来说,学习大数据技术不仅是对技术的掌握,更是对数据思维与分析能力的提升。
掌握大数据技术,不仅能够为个人职业发展提供助力,还能为社会创造价值。因此,在学习过程中,应保持热情,注重实践,不断提升自身能力,为未来的发展打下坚实的基础。
在当今信息化迅猛发展的时代,大数据技术已成为各行各业不可或缺的重要工具。它不仅改变了传统行业的运作模式,还催生了大量新兴的岗位与职业。对于初学者而言,学习大数据技术是一条既充满挑战又充满机遇的旅程。本文将从多个角度探讨大数据技术学习的课程体系,帮助读者明确学习路径,提升学习效率。
一、大数据技术概述与学习目标
大数据技术是指利用先进的数据处理工具和算法,从海量数据中提取有价值的信息,从而支持决策和优化运营的科学方法。大数据技术涉及的数据范围广泛,数据量巨大,处理方式复杂,因此学习大数据技术需要系统性的知识体系。
学习大数据技术的目标包括:掌握数据采集、存储、处理、分析、可视化等关键技术,了解大数据在不同行业的应用,培养数据思维能力,提升解决实际问题的能力。学习过程中,不仅需要扎实的编程基础,还需要理解数据科学的基本原理,以及大数据平台的使用方法。
二、大数据技术学习的基础课程
1. 编程语言与数据处理
编程是大数据技术学习的基础,掌握一门或多门编程语言(如Python、Java、R等)是入门的必要条件。Python因其简洁易懂、功能强大,在大数据领域应用广泛,是学习大数据技术的首选语言。
学习Python时,应重点掌握数据结构、算法、函数、类、模块等基础知识。此外,学习数据处理相关工具如Pandas、NumPy、Matplotlib等,有助于提升数据操作能力。
2. 数据库与数据存储
数据存储是大数据技术的重要环节。学习数据库的基本概念与结构,包括关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B、Redis),是掌握数据处理流程的关键。
在学习过程中,应熟悉数据库的设计、优化、备份与恢复机制,以及数据索引、查询、事务处理等技能。同时,了解分布式数据库如Hadoop、HBase等的原理,也是学习大数据技术的重要内容。
3. 大数据平台与工具
大数据技术的核心在于平台与工具的使用。常见的大数据平台包括Hadoop、Spark、Flink、Hive、HBase、MapReduce等。学习这些平台的原理、配置、使用方法以及性能调优是掌握大数据技术的关键。
此外,学习大数据可视化工具如Tableau、Power BI、Python的Matplotlib、Seaborn等,也能够提升数据呈现与分析的能力。
4. 数据分析与机器学习
数据分析是大数据技术的核心应用之一。学习数据清洗、数据挖掘、数据建模、统计分析等技能,是提升数据价值的关键。同时,掌握机器学习算法与模型,如线性回归、决策树、随机森林、神经网络等,也是大数据技术学习的重要内容。
在学习过程中,应注重实际案例的分析与实践,以增强对数据科学的理解与应用能力。
三、大数据技术学习的进阶课程
5. 大数据处理与计算
学习大数据处理与计算是掌握大数据技术的重要环节。掌握分布式计算框架如Hadoop、Spark、Flink等,是提升数据处理效率的关键。
在学习过程中,应重点掌握分布式计算的基本原理、任务调度、数据分布与分区、容错机制等。此外,学习Spark的RDD、DataFrame、DAG等概念,也是提升大数据处理能力的重要内容。
6. 数据科学与统计学
数据科学与统计学是大数据技术学习的重要支撑学科。学习统计学的基本概念,如概率、假设检验、回归分析、置信区间等,是理解数据背后的规律和趋势的基础。
同时,学习数据科学中的机器学习、特征工程、模型评估与优化等技能,也是提升数据分析能力的重要内容。
7. 数据可视化与报告
数据可视化是将复杂的数据转化为直观的图表和报告的重要手段。学习数据可视化工具如Tableau、Power BI、Python的Plotly、Matplotlib、Seaborn等,是提升数据沟通能力的关键。
在学习过程中,应注重图表的设计、数据的呈现方式以及报告的撰写技巧,以增强数据表达与传播的能力。
四、大数据技术学习的实践课程
8. 数据采集与处理实践
数据采集与处理是大数据技术应用的起点。学习数据采集工具如Scrapy、Selenium、Apache Nifi等,是掌握数据获取与处理流程的基础。
在实践过程中,应熟悉数据清洗、去重、分组、统计等操作,以及数据导出与导入的方法,以提升数据处理能力。
9. 大数据项目实践
大数据项目实践是检验学习成果的重要方式。通过参与实际项目,如数据分析、数据建模、数据可视化等,可以提升实际操作能力和团队协作能力。
在项目实践中,应注重问题分析、数据处理、模型构建、结果呈现等环节,以增强对大数据技术的理解与应用能力。
五、大数据技术学习的行业应用与职业发展
10. 大数据在各行业的应用
大数据技术已经广泛应用于金融、医疗、教育、制造、零售、政府等多个行业。例如,在金融行业,大数据技术用于风险控制、欺诈检测和投资决策;在医疗行业,大数据技术用于疾病预测、药物研发和个性化治疗;在教育行业,大数据技术用于学生行为分析、课程推荐和教学优化。
学习大数据技术,不仅能够掌握核心技术,还能了解大数据在不同行业的应用,为未来的职业发展打下坚实基础。
11. 大数据相关职业发展路径
大数据技术的学习,为个人职业发展提供了广阔的空间。常见的职业包括数据分析师、数据科学家、大数据工程师、数据可视化设计师、数据产品经理等。
在职业发展过程中,应注重提升专业技能,积累项目经验,加强行业认知,以提高就业竞争力。
六、大数据技术学习的注意事项
12. 学习路径的规划与持续学习
学习大数据技术是一项长期的过程,需要合理规划学习路径,分阶段掌握基础知识,逐步深入学习高级技能。同时,应保持持续学习,关注行业动态,提升自身竞争力。
13. 实践与理论结合
理论学习与实践操作相结合是提升学习效果的关键。通过实际项目、案例分析、实验操作等方式,能够更深入地理解大数据技术的原理与应用。
14. 专业认证与职业发展
获得大数据相关的专业认证,如阿里云大数据工程师、Hadoop认证、Spark认证等,是提升职业竞争力的重要途径。同时,应关注行业内的职业发展机会,积极参与行业交流与合作,拓展职业网络。
大数据技术的学习是一个系统而复杂的工程,涉及多个学科和技能。从基础的编程语言与数据处理,到进阶的大数据平台与分析工具,再到实际项目的实践与职业发展,学习路径清晰而严谨。对于初学者来说,学习大数据技术不仅是对技术的掌握,更是对数据思维与分析能力的提升。
掌握大数据技术,不仅能够为个人职业发展提供助力,还能为社会创造价值。因此,在学习过程中,应保持热情,注重实践,不断提升自身能力,为未来的发展打下坚实的基础。
推荐文章
基础指挥要求是什么在任何组织或系统中,指挥是实现目标和协调行动的关键环节。指挥要求的制定和执行,不仅决定了行动的效率和效果,也直接影响到整体任务的完成。本文将围绕“基础指挥要求是什么”这一主题,深入探讨指挥的核心要素、基本原则、执行要
2026-05-16 04:31:50
167人看过
腾讯退钱要求是什么?腾讯公司作为中国互联网行业的领军企业,其产品和服务覆盖了社交、游戏、金融、娱乐等多个领域。随着互联网行业的快速发展,用户在使用腾讯产品过程中,可能会遇到一些问题,如支付失败、服务中断、退款请求等。在这些情况下,用户
2026-05-16 04:31:00
47人看过
支架抗震要求是什么在建筑施工中,支架作为支撑结构的重要组成部分,其抗震性能直接影响到整个建筑的安全性与稳定性。无论是在地震多发区,还是在其他复杂地质条件下,支架的抗震设计都是确保工程顺利实施的关键环节。本文将深入探讨支架抗震要求的相关
2026-05-16 04:30:56
164人看过
现代技术教育是什么课程现代技术教育是当代社会中一种重要且不可或缺的教育形式,其核心在于培养学生的科技素养与实践能力。随着信息技术的迅猛发展,技术教育已不再局限于传统的学科领域,而是渗透到各个教育阶段,成为推动社会进步与个人发展的重要力
2026-05-16 04:30:45
126人看过



